STUDENTS FINANCIAL SUPPORT OFFICE CONNECTS WITH NEW STUDENTS AT VALCO HALL AND COLLEGE OF DISTANCE EDUCATION
On 12 January 2026, the Students Financial Support Office of the University of Cape Coast (UCC) held an outreach session for Level 100 students at VALCO Hall and freshers at the College of Distance Education (CoDE). The initiative aimed to formally introduce first-year students to the UCC Scholarship for Needy but Brilliant Students and to raise awareness of the financial support opportunities available to eligible students.
The session was led by Mrs. Alice Okyere, Head of the Students Financial Support Office, who delivered an informative and interactive presentation. She outlined the purpose of the scholarship, explained the eligibility criteria, and provided step-by-step guidance on the application process, including key timelines. Students were encouraged to take advantage of the opportunity and to visit the Office for further clarification or support.
The outreach was well received and successfully increased awareness of the vital financial assistance available to students facing financial challenges at UCC, reinforcing the University’s commitment to supporting academic excellence and inclusivity.
